Bitdefender

Autopilot mode makes all decisions automatically without user popups
Consistently top-ranked in AV-TEST and AV-Comparatives independent labs
Minimal CPU footprint compared to competitor suites at same protection level
Advanced threat defense uses behavioral analysis not just signatures
Network threat prevention blocks exploits before they reach the OS
Advanced features require Total Security tier which is expensive
Customer support response times can be slow on weekends

Datadog Security

Cloud SIEM correlates logs and metrics from 700 plus integrations automatically
Cloud Security Management detects misconfigurations in real-time across AWS and Azure
Application Security Management finds OWASP vulnerabilities in production code
Unified platform means security alerts link directly to performance metrics context
Threat intelligence integrations with Recorded Future and other providers built-in
Data ingestion pricing model can produce unexpectedly high bills during incidents
Security features require existing Datadog APM subscription adding total cost
